Why checkboxes and tags are awesome and dangerous
One of the most common functions in an AMS is the concept of checkboxes and/or tags (your system may have both!). With checkboxes and tags we can easily "group" otherwise disparate data sets together. For example, need to create a VIP list of people to invite to your annual awards dinner? Create a checkbox or a tag called "VIP list" and start adding them!
So easy to create and query on! But of course, there's a problem with this.
The problem, as I discussed in a previous newsletter, is that more often than not, these tags or checkboxes are not actively managed. And so the data quickly becomes incorrect.
And worse than that, checkboxes and tags are often used in a redundant manner. For example, I'll frequently find clients using checkboxes to track members when the membership status is already being tracked somewhere else in the system. When I ask my clients why they do this, they almost invariably say "It's easier to see and query this way."
But what I see happen too often is that these checkboxes are not being updated when membership status changes, e.g., when a member drops. So very soon, the data is wrong.
Tags and checkboxes are awesome because they are easy to create, easy to read and understand, and easy to query on. But like all data points, they require active management. So use them judiciously and make sure you keep them up to date (or get rid of them!).
Wes's Wednesday Wisdom Archives
Data integrity reports
Data integrity reports I speak and write a lot about data integrity reports. So I […]
The most important training tip
The most important training tip I’ve been sitting in a lot of database training sessions […]
Be careful about getting tangled
Be careful about getting tangled “We had done a lot to tangle ourselves up.” – […]
Discipline. Always discipline.
Discipline. Always discipline. I’ve been producing a newsletter in some form for over 25 years […]
Simpler is better
Simpler is better Recently, a client of mine was discussing how they manage membership reinstatements. […]
Baby steps
Baby Steps A journey of a thousand miles begins with a single step. You have […]
Sometimes what you’re using IS the best option
Sometimes what you’re using IS the best option I love technology and I’m inherently lazy, […]
Do they hate the system?
Do they hate the system? When an association asks me for help finding a new […]
Artificial Intelligence is the next revolution in data management
Artificial Intelligence is the next revolution in data management I’ve been in the data management […]
There’s always gonna be something
There’s always gonna be something I’ve been consulting for 26 years now and I’m still […]